Description
Welcome to the Year of the Rabbit with live performances and activities by our amazing community partners.
We're thrilled to see the return of the exciting and colourful lion dance. Catch vibrant song and dance performances, marvel at the martial arts demonstrations, and learn about Chinese and Korean culture. There are plenty of craft and traditional activities, and look out for our roving pandas! You can also buy beautiful Chinese goods for sale in the shop.
During the celebrations, pick up one of our rabbit detective trails to search for rabbits throughout the museum!
The Year of the Rabbit starts on 22 Jan 2023 and finishes on 9 Feb 2023.
According to the Chinese Zodiac, people born in a year of the Rabbit are kind-hearted, witty and cheerful. People born in this year have pink and purple as their lucky colours.
